Working out what yours is worth
- Polish it gently and photograph it clean
- Test the clasp opens and closes securely
Getting it ready
- Work the clasp a dozen times and check the spring or lobster mechanism holds firmly.
- Measure the length, weigh it, and clean gently with a silver cloth rather than a dip.
Photograph
- The necklace laid in a curve, whole
- Any pendant, plus tarnish, kinks, worn links or repairs
Put in the description
- Metal and hallmark, photographed
- Clasp type and condition, and any kinked or repaired link

Does the clasp work properly?
Test it repeatedly and answer. A failing clasp means a lost necklace, so buyers treat it as a functional fault rather than a cosmetic one.
